**Onboarding: Pointsledger Basics**

For this week's eng sync: the Bramblewick loyalty-points ledger is append-only; every accrual and redemption writes a signed entry, and balances are derived, never stored. Reconciliation runs nightly against the Tillhouse snapshot. To exercise the staging ledger locally, configure your client with the internal key that follows.

API key for tagef-fafop: vxb2-ta

Test plan: rate limiting, Kestrelgate internal gateway. Scope: verify 429s fire at 500 req/min per client, burst allowance of 50, and that headers report remaining quota. On-call: if limits trip in prod, check the Ashford config map before escalating — most incidents are stale limits after a deploy. Synthetic load runs every six hours from the canary pool; alerts page only on sustained breach. To run the manual probe against staging, authenticate with the bearer token below:

portal login ticket: eyJhbGciOiJIUzI1NiIsInR5cCI6IkpXVCJ9.eyJzdWIiOiIwEOsktwVNwIn0.-UJU3fdyyCgG

## Recovery: Orchestra migration account

Cron jobs on the legacy Pellworth scheduler are being moved to the Windlass workflow engine. Plugin authors whose migration account is locked mid-transfer should not re-register; duplicate accounts break job ownership mapping. Instead, use the standard recovery flow from the migration console and confirm your plugin manifest checksum when prompted. The flow requires the escrowed recovery passphrase, which is recorded directly below this paragraph.

strongbox words: zormir-quenath-sorax

## Artifact Signing — Shelfwise Cache Plugins

Plugins that handle cache invalidation for the Shelfwise product catalog must ship signed bundles. The Brambleton loader verifies each bundle before it can touch invalidation hooks. Unsigned or mismatched bundles are quarantined. Sign your plugin with your own key, and verify our releases using the key published below. The current release verification key is:

rollout seal: bky9_aBG1gvAyU